Output 3fc04ade7d128cef560860a4628d81abccb0726f12a88d314c674da7b6ebf02d:1

value
13643410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 695ed5b0b31ce194be1dd80d4918c98594e23c19 OP_EQUAL
address
3BJAUvDWoKayEysrfWG8VTR5uPC3D8nCrB
transaction
3fc04ade7d128cef560860a4628d81abccb0726f12a88d314c674da7b6ebf02d
spent
true